When looking for an affordable laser cutter, there are several options available that cater to different needs, from beginners to more experienced users. Here are some options:
1. AtomStack Mini Laser: This is a budget-friendly machine that is portable and can cut a wide range of materials. It's an excellent choice for beginners and hobbyists due to its aluminum alloy design and focused UV eye protection.
2. Ortur Laser Master Series: Ortur offers laser engraving machines that are known for their efficiency and precision. The Laser Master 2 Pro (OLM2 Pro) and Laser Master 3 are examples of machines that provide high-speed engraving with safety features.
3. Comgrow Z1: This machine is praised for its cutting speed and accuracy in a small package. It's available in 5W and 10W options, with the latter being better for cutting tougher materials like metal or coated glass.
4. SainSmart Genmitsu LE 5040: With a slightly larger cutting area compared to the Comgrow Z1, this budget laser cutter is user-friendly and can be used for a variety of materials, including wood, MDF, anodized aluminum, paper, textiles, acrylic, and more.
5. Jinsoku LC-60A: This model from Genmitsu comes with a larger cutting area and an integrated Air Assist feature and compressor, which reduces burning and produces cleaner cuts.
6. Two Tree’s TTS-55: A 5-watt diode laser cutter/engraver that's good for beginners. It's easy to use and produces quality engravings quickly.
7. xTool S1: A fully enclosed, 40-watt diode laser that offers cutting power comparable to CO2 lasers at a more affordable price. It's suitable for those looking to start a small business or expand their capabilities.
8. WeCreat Vision: A 20-watt diode laser engraver/cutter with a fully enclosed workspace, making it safe for various environments. It features an integrated auto-focus and is ideal for professionals and hobbyists.
9. Glowforge Aura: Designed for home crafting, this laser cutter is smaller and less powerful than other models but works well for smaller projects.
10. xTool F1: A portable laser engraver that is lightweight and easy to transport, making it ideal for craft fair vendors and small workspaces.
When choosing an affordable laser cutter, consider factors such as the machine's power, working area, ease of use, safety features, and the materials you plan to work with. It's also important to read user reviews and consider the reputation of the manufacturer to ensure you're making a wise investment.
